# SQL Server 时间格式与LIKE的应用
在数据库管理中,SQL Server 是一种广泛使用的关系型数据库管理系统。时间格式对于数据的管理和查询至关重要。本文将探讨 SQL Server 中的时间格式以及如何结合 `LIKE` 操作符进行有效查询,并提供一系列示例代码帮助你更好地理解这一概念。
## SQL Server 时间格式概述
在 SQL Server 中,时间数据类型有
### 如何实现MySQL日期格式like
作为一名经验丰富的开发者,我将教会你如何实现MySQL日期格式like。首先,让我们通过以下表格展示整个流程: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 连接到MySQL数据库 |
| 2 | 编写SQL查询语句 |
| 3 | 使用LIKE操作符进行日期格式匹配 |
接下来,我们将详细说明每一步需要做什么以及使用的代码。
原创
2024-06-11 06:23:32
40阅读
# 实现“mysql json 格式数据like”教程
## 整体流程
首先,我们需要了解如何在 MySQL 中处理 JSON 格式的数据。然后,我们将学习如何使用 `LIKE` 操作符在 JSON 字段中查询特定的数据。最后,我们会通过实际的例子演示如何实现这一功能。
以下是整个过程的步骤表格:
| 步骤 | 操作 |
| --- | --- |
| 1 | 查询 JSON 字段 |
|
原创
2024-04-11 06:47:08
290阅读
# 如何实现"mysql like 当前时间"
## 1. 简介
在MySQL中,我们可以使用LIKE运算符来进行模糊查询,如`SELECT * FROM table_name WHERE column_name LIKE '%keyword%'`。而对于当前时间,我们可以使用NOW()函数来获取当前的日期和时间。因此,"mysql like 当前时间"的实现就是将当前时间转换为字符串,并与表
原创
2023-08-22 08:59:36
193阅读
# MySQL 时间 LIKE 模糊查询入门指南
在数据库开发中,有时我们需要对时间字段进行模糊查询。MySQL 的 `LIKE` 关键词常被用于字符串匹配,但在某些情况下,也可以对日期或时间进行模糊匹配。在这篇文章中,我将教你如何通过几个简单的步骤,实现 MySQL 中的时间字段模糊查询。
## 整体流程
以下是实现 MySQL 时间 LIKE 模糊查询的步骤:
| 步骤 | 描述
日期和时间数据类型下表列出了 SQL 的日期和时间数据类型:数据类型格式范围精确度存储大小(字节)用户定义的秒的小数部分精度时区偏移量timehh:mm:ss[.nnnnnnn]00:00:00.0000000 到 23:59:59.9999999100 纳秒3 到 5是否dateYYYY-MM-DD0001-01-01 到 31.12.991 天3否否smalldatetimeYYYY-MM-D
转载
2023-10-18 23:04:29
144阅读
sql server2000中使用convert来取得datetime数据类型样式(全)日期数据格式的处理,两个示例:CONVERT(varchar(16), 时间一, 20) 结果:2007-02-01 08:02/*时间一般为getdate()函数或数据表里的字段*/CONVERT(varchar(10), 时间一, 23) 结果:2007-02-01 /*varchar(10)表示日期输出的
转载
2023-12-01 10:45:19
63阅读
# MySQL中使用regexp_like检验yyddmm格式
在进行数据处理和分析时,经常需要对数据进行格式验证。在MySQL中,可以使用`regexp_like`函数来实现正则表达式匹配,从而进行格式验证。本文将介绍如何使用`regexp_like`函数来检验yyddmm格式的日期数据。
## yyddmm格式说明
yyddmm格式是一种简单的日期格式,其中yy表示年份的后两位数字,dd
原创
2024-03-02 06:48:19
162阅读
# 实现mysql like not like的步骤
## 1. 创建数据库和表格
首先,我们需要创建一个数据库并在其中创建一个表格来进行演示。假设我们创建的表格名为`users`,包含以下字段:
- id:用户ID,数据类型为整数
- name:用户姓名,数据类型为字符串
- age:用户年龄,数据类型为整数
我们可以使用以下的SQL语句来创建数据库和表格:
```sql
CREATE DA
原创
2023-10-03 08:14:47
118阅读
# 如何实现“mysql like当前那时间”
## 概述
在实现“mysql like当前那时间”功能时,我们首先需要了解这个功能的实现流程,然后按照步骤逐步完成。本文将详细介绍整个流程,并给出每一步所需的代码示例和解释。
## 实现流程
下面是实现“mysql like当前那时间”功能的步骤表格:
| 步骤 | 操作 |
| --- | --- |
| 1 | 获取当前时间 |
| 2
原创
2024-06-13 03:40:03
18阅读
日期时间函数1、获取子值,值为整数类型,函数如下year(date)返回date的年份(范围在1000到9999)
month(date)返回date中的月份数值
day(date)返回date中的日期数值
hour(time)返回time的小时数(范围是0到23)
minute(time)返回time的分钟数(范围是0到59)
second(time)返回time的秒数(范围是0到59)
sel
转载
2023-06-04 17:30:53
218阅读
mysql语句中like用法是什么mysql语句中like用法:1、搭配【%】使用,【%】代表一个或多个字符的通配符;2、搭配【_】使用,【_】代表仅仅一个字符的通配符。mysql语句中like用法:1、常见用法:(1)搭配%使用%代表一个或多个字符的通配符,譬如查询字段name中以大开头的数据:(2)搭配_使用_代表仅仅一个字符的通配符,把上面那条查询语句中的%改为_,会发现只能查询出一条数据。
转载
2023-11-05 10:26:26
146阅读
前言我们都知道 InnoDB 在模糊查询数据时使用 "%xx" 会导致索引失效,但有时需求就是如此,类似这样的需求还有很多,例如,搜索引擎需要根基用户数据的关键字进行全文查找,电子商务网站需要根据用户的查询条件,在可能需要在商品的详细介绍中进行查找,这些都不是B+树索引能很好完成的工作。通过数值比较,范围过滤等就可以完成绝大多数我们需要的查询了。但是,如果希望通过关键字的匹配来进行查询过滤,那么就
转载
2024-08-07 07:56:24
41阅读
个人首先不是很懂Mysql数据库,今天用到了它的日期相关操作才现学现找。首先声明:以下函数都是可以内嵌在Mysql数据库的sql语句中进行执行的1,获取当前时间 : now() select now() 即可查询返回当前的系统时间2,日期时间选取函数:select date('2008-09-10 07:15:30.123456') 通过 se
转载
2023-06-04 20:28:15
103阅读
# 如何在 MySQL 中实现时间格式的存储与操作
在开发中,处理时间和日期是非常常见的需求。MySQL提供了多种日期和时间数据类型,可以帮助你更有效地管理这些信息。本文将介绍如何在MySQL中实现时间格式的存储与使用,分步骤进行讲解,并提供相关代码示例和流程图。
## 整体流程
下面是我们实现时间格式操作的整体流程:
| 步骤 | 描述 |
原创
2024-09-08 04:43:33
37阅读
## 如何实现“mysql 格式时间”
### 概述
在 mysql 数据库中,时间是以特定的格式进行存储和表示的。如果我们想要在开发中使用 mysql 格式时间,我们需要经过以下几个步骤:
1. 获取当前时间
2. 将当前时间格式化为 mysql 格式
3. 将格式化后的时间存储到数据库中
4. 从数据库中读取 mysql 格式的时间并进行处理
下面我将逐步解释每个步骤的具体操作,并提供
原创
2023-09-06 11:00:54
47阅读
# MySQL 时间格式的实现
## 引言
MySQL 是一种常见的关系型数据库管理系统,提供了强大的时间处理功能。在开发中,经常会遇到需要对时间进行格式化、计算和存储的需求。本文将介绍如何在 MySQL 中实现时间格式化的功能,并提供了详细的步骤和示例代码。
## 流程概述
下面的表格展示了整个实现过程的流程步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个包
原创
2023-08-21 08:51:57
69阅读
# MySQL格式时间
MySQL是一种常用的关系型数据库管理系统,支持存储和检索数据。在MySQL中,时间是一个重要的数据类型之一。MySQL提供了多种不同的格式来表示时间,以便满足各种需求。
## 1. 日期和时间类型
在MySQL中,有多种日期和时间类型可供选择,包括`DATE`、`TIME`、`DATETIME`、`TIMESTAMP`和`YEAR`等。
- `DATE`:用于存储
原创
2023-11-20 04:38:18
190阅读
MySQL毫秒值和日期转换,MYSQL内置函数FROM_UNIXTIME:
select FROM_UNIXTIME(t.createDate/1000,'%Y-%m-%d %h:%i:%s') as cd from task t where taskStatus='1';
SELECT FROM_UNIXTIME(time/1000,'%Y-%m-%d %h:%i:%s') FROM `log
转载
2023-07-01 11:09:01
293阅读
表示时间值的日期和时间类型为DATETIME、DATE、TIMESTAMP、TIME和YEAR。每个时间类型有一个有效值范围和一个"零"值,当指定不合法的MySQL不能表示的值时使用"零"值。1,DATE范围 1000-01-01/9999-12-31格式 YYYY-MM-DD2,TIME范围 '-838:59:59'/'838:59:59'格式 HH:MM:SS3,YEAR范围 19
转载
2023-06-04 20:45:14
202阅读